 Partition Pruner has logic reusable like
 1. walk through operator tree
 2. walk through operation tree
 3. create pruning predicate
 The first candidate is list bucketing pruner.
 Some consideration:
 1. refactor for general use case not just list bucketing
 2. avoid over-refactor by focusing on pieces targeted for reuse
